Hi, last summer when we went to WDW we were there during the time that seasonal pricing takes effect - we had read about it on the allears site. I was wondering if it still in effect for this summer - the allears site does not have dates listed - there is only a disclaimer that seasonal pricing may be in effect during peak times. Just wondering if anyone knew if it was set in stone that next week would include the seasonal pricing?? :confused3 I seem to remember that last summer they had listed seasonal pricing from Memorial Day thru to 4th of July weekend.

Oh and we pay OOP we do not do DDP.

Thanks :goodvibes
 
Apparently it is in effect but they have not announced exact dates for 2010. I'd go in expecting to pay the extra at fixed-price restaurants (it does not apply to all restaurants, only the Disney-operated ones that charge per person)
